Israel Aerospace Industries and Elbit Systems announced yesterday (September 1.9.05, XNUMX) the start of work and the execution of the contract for the supply of drone systems to the Turkish army.
As I recall, the contract with the Turkish Ministry of Defense was signed in May of this year by IUP (Israeli UAV Program) with the Aerospace Industry and Elbit, in an equal partnership.
IUP is the main contractor of Tusas Aerospace Industry (TAI) in the program, and it will supply the drone systems to the Turkish Ministry of Defense. The duration of supply is about 3 years.
The scope of the contract for TEA and Elbit is 150 million dollars, and the systems that will be supplied will be operated by the Turkish army.
